Sewer Backup Water Removal Cost in Sherborn, MA
The cost of sewer backup water removal can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Sherborn, MA.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, type of equ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,500 | Type of equipment needed, size of affected area |
| Disinfection and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Type of disinfectants needed, size of affected area |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and a free estimate is always available.
